The Opportunity

As part of the Corporate Technology Strategy team you will drive innovative solutions that leverage blockchain technology to address complex business challenges. As a Senior Associate, you will analyze intricate problems, mentor junior team members, and build meaningful client relationships while navigating the evolving landscape of technology. This role offers the chance to work at the forefront of digital transformation, contributing to strategic initiatives that align technology capabilities with business goals.

What Sets You Apart

- Master's Degree in Business Administration preferred

- Certification(s) preferred: Certified Blockchain Expert (CBE) or Certified Blockchain Solution Architects (CBSA)

- Demonstrating a foundational understanding of blockchain technology concepts, including distributed ledgers, consensus mechanisms, tokenization models, and key industry applications

- Working knowledge of blockchain architecture components such as wallets, nodes, APIs, and integration layers

- Having exposure to smart contract development, testing, or deployment using platforms such as Ethereum, Stellar, or Solana

- Using business and technical acumen to assess blockchain use cases and describe their value potential to clients

- Supporting delivery of blockchain projects including strategy assessments, proof of concept implementations, production rollouts, etc.

- Familiarity with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) and DevOps concepts supporting blockchain implementations
